Donald Trump's win 'bad news for the auto industry,' says David Dodge

A former bank of Canada governor says opening up the North American Free Trade Agreement, as Prime Minister Justin Trudeau has suggested after Donald Trump’s presidential win, will be dangerous for the automotive and parts industry.
